The problem? No.

I do believe he has put up a lot of unimpactful numbers in his career thus far, but I don't think he's a cancer or anything.

I think there is a lot of talk on this forum right now about him being what fans want him to be and believe he can be, but that doesn't mean he's shown it thus far. To this point, he's never shown the ability to make a large difference in winning basketball games. *should* he be able to be a defensive anchor? Yes.

He's got the physical talent and size, but his motor has often been an issue, and I don't think he plays anywhere near to within his limitations.

All of that said, he's made multiple all-star games for reasons, and he is capable of leaving his large footprint on games. I believe he could be one of the better players on a really good team if he plays focused and within himself.

I agree. Drummond gets something of a bad rap, but he just puts up numbers. He’s a big dude who gobbles up rebounds. He can flash at times and make tough plays look easy, leaving people wanting more. Make no mistake, his motor doesn’t rev like some guys, he’s probably not diving on the court for loose balls, and he can look lazy or lackadaisical. It’s his smooth play, calm demeanor, and lack of urgency that drives people nuts. Drummond is your typical gentle giant.

He can play his role on a winning squad. He’s just not a guy you want to count on too much offensively. I’d put his value around that of Clint Capela. Even if Drummond doesn’t play with the same type of suddenness that Capela does, it doesn’t negate his impact.

JaVale McGee plays harder and can make arguably more of an impact, on both ends of the floor. However, he’s not as durable and he’s not the space eater that Drummond is, which is why he’s better off the bench.
